Detroit Tigers @ Philadelphia Athletics

1931-07-14 Β· Day game Β· Shibe Park Β· Att: 3000 Β· 2:05

Detroit Tigers defeated Philadelphia Athletics 12–3. Detroit Tigers put up 4 in the 9th. Art Herring earned the win. John Stone went 2-for-5 with 1 HR and 3 RBI.
